#093f01 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#093f01 is composed of 3.5% red, 24.7%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 75.3% black. It has a hue angle of 112.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 12.5%. #093f01 color hex could be obtained by blending #127e02 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

#093f01 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#093f01 has RGB values of R:9, G:63,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 605953.

Shades and Tints of #093f01
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010500 is the darkest color, while #f3fff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#093f01
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1f211f is the less saturated color, while #093f01 is the most saturated one.
